A central Ohio man was sentenced to prison for embezzling more than 26 million dollars from the company he worked for.

Yi He, 26, of Powell, was sentenced to five years in prison on Wednesday, according to a statement from the United States Department of Justice.Yi will also have to pay restitution and forfeit a Tesla vehicle, according to the statement.From 2018 to 2022, Yi took money from the company's bank account and deposited it into his own. Yi also submitted false and fraudulent financial documents to the leadership of the company undetected, according to the statement.

At one point, Yi wired himself $100,000 and then removed the transaction completely from the bank account of the company, according to the statement. According to the statement, Yi failed to report his income to the IRS between the years of 2018 to 2021. Yi stole $26.5 million from the company.Stay Connected
